Hydro Out In McBride -Valemount Region

By 250 News

Tuesday, May 05, 2009 08:59 AM

McBride, B.C.-   It will be about 2:00 this afternoon before electricity has been restored to more than five thousand customers from Dome Creek to Valemount on highway 16 and  south along highway 5  to Barriere.
B.C. Hydro says the electricity was cut about 1:30 this morning. 
B.C. Hydro's Bob Gammer says it was a pole fire "An insulator failed,  sometimes  there can be a hairline crack in an insulator, allowing moisture to get in,  and that gives electricity a path to the pole where  the pole heats up and  eventually starts on fire."
